Day 1: Shibuya Crossing & Harajuku
Immerse in Tokyo's Pulsating Heart
Begin your Tokyo adventure at the world-famous Shibuya Crossing, where thousands of pedestrians cross in perfect harmony. Witness this urban symphony from street level before enjoying lunch at Uobei Sushi's conveyor belt experience.
Explore the vibrant youth culture of Harajuku along Takeshita Street, then find tranquility at the majestic Meiji Jingu Shrine, tucked within a peaceful forest in the heart of Tokyo.
Pro Tip: Visit Shibuya Sky observation deck at sunset for breathtaking views of the crossing illuminated by Tokyo's neon lights.

Day 3: Sophisticated Roppongi & Elegant Omotesando
Local Legend: Roppongi was once a small village before becoming Tokyo's cosmopolitan center. Its name translates to "six trees," referring to six tall zelkova trees that once marked the area.
Art & Design Immersion
Begin your day with a visit to the Meiji Memorial Picture Gallery, showcasing important historical artworks depicting Japan's transformation into a modern nation.
After a hands-on ceramics workshop and lunch at the celebrated Afuri Ramen, explore Roppongi's cultural treasures at the Mori Art Museum and 21_21 Design Sight—architectural marvels housing cutting-edge exhibitions.
As evening falls, indulge in an exquisite dinner at Ukai-Tei Omotesando, known for its perfect blend of French techniques and Japanese ingredients. Cap your night with breathtaking city views from the Roppongi Hills Sky Deck.

Day 4: Futuristic Odaiba & Relaxing Onsen
Digital Wonderland & Traditional Relaxation
Today is dedicated to experiencing Tokyo's perfect blend of future and tradition. Begin at teamLab Borderless, an immersive digital art museum where boundaries between artworks dissolve, creating a borderless world of moving masterpieces that respond to your presence.
After lunch at Aquacity Odaiba, unwind at Oedo Onsen Monogatari, a theme park-style hot spring complex designed as an Edo-period town. Soak in mineral-rich waters and experience traditional bathing culture that has rejuvenated Japanese people for centuries.

From High Fashion to Neon Lights
Begin your day at Hamarikyu Gardens, a tranquil traditional garden that provides stunning contrast against Tokyo's modern skyline. Sip matcha at the teahouse overlooking the pond before exploring Ginza Six, Tokyo's most luxurious shopping complex.
Witness the artistry of Kabuki at the historic Kabuki-za Theatre, then explore Ginza's upscale department stores like Mitsukoshi. Later, venture to Akihabara for a night of sensory overload, starting with a visit to Kanda Myojin Shrine—protector of electronic devices.
As night falls, experience Akihabara's vibrant nightlife at MOGRA nightclub and themed bars like the retro gaming GASTRO PUB A-Button.

Pro Tip: Single-act Kabuki tickets are available on the day of performance, perfect for experiencing this traditional art form without committing to a full-length show.

Day 9: Farewell to Tokyo
Final Moments in the Imperial City
Before departing, savor a leisurely breakfast at your hotel and complete any last-minute preparations. Take a final stroll through the Imperial Palace East Gardens, where centuries of history unfold among meticulously maintained Japanese landscapes, stone walls, and seasonal blooms.
Capture lasting memories at the iconic Nijubashi Bridge, its elegant double arches reflected in the water below—a perfect final image of Tokyo's harmonious blend of natural beauty and human craftsmanship.

Transfer Options
Direct train service connects Tokyo Station to both Haneda (30 minutes) and Narita (60 minutes) airports. For cruise departures, private transfers can be arranged through your hotel concierge.
Luggage Services
Tokyo Station offers same-day luggage delivery to the airport, allowing you to enjoy your final hours in the city unencumbered.
